Frequently asked

How do you write Barry in kanji?
Barry can be written as 馬利 (read “Bari”), among other ateji combinations. Each kanji is chosen so its Japanese reading matches the sounds of the name.
What does the name Barry mean in Japanese?
Because Barry is written with ateji (phonetic kanji), the meaning comes from the characters chosen. This page shows combinations themed around Power, Beauty, Wisdom, Nature, and Courage, each with the meaning of every character.
Is Barry in kanji a real translation?
It is an ateji rendering — kanji selected to match the pronunciation of Barry while carrying positive meanings. It is the same approach used for foreign names in Japanese.
